cmmi-项目估算过程及估算表(9个文件)softwareestimationprocess(编辑修改稿)内容摘要:
.............................. 7 7. 参考资料 ....................................................................................................................................................................... 8 软件项目估算过程 编号 : JBM/STDPRC120 版本 : 20xx 年 4 月 10 日 第 4 页 共 8 页 软件项目估算过程 1. 概述 软件估算的目的是通过对软件项目管理和开发工作量的估算 , 确认项目开发的成本 , 开发周期以作为项目投标 , 立项的依据 . 对项目的估算通常还包括对软件大小 (Size) 和关键计算机资源的估算 . 软件项目的估算不是一次估算过程 . 通常会对项目估算多次 . 例如在商务过程中 , 通过估算进行报价和投标。 在项目计划过程中 , 通过估算以确定项目开发计划。 在里程碑评审是 , 通过估算和总结调整项目计划 . 随着各种信息的不断收集和完善 , 以及经验的积累 , 项目估算会越来越准确 . 对软件的估算狠难以精确或准确来衡量 , 相反以其合理性来评估 . 项目的估算通常和市场价格 , 商务目标 , 项目经验 , 和 开发成员的工作弹性相关并是上述方面的综合反映 . 2. 估算过程 开始估计系统大小或程序单元即时进行变更处理是否估计过程估计工作量大小估计时间进度表估计计算机资源 3. 基于 SBS 的估算方法 系统分解和单元估算 参照系统结构分解表 , 进行系统分解 , 确认系统的程序单元以及程序单元的级别,可以分为简单、中等、复杂( S/M/C),在确认的过程中,尽可能的参照以往的项目。 如果指定项目的基线不存在,根据项目的类型,技术,语言和其他属性,在基线库中查找类似的项目,基于以往项目的历史数据,对指定项目的程序单元进行划分和确认。 如果在基线数据库中没有类似的项目存在, 并且,指定项目的基线数据库也不存在,使用公司标准过程进行构架系统程序单元大小( S/M/C)的估计和确认。 软件项目估算过程 编号 : JBM/STDPRC120 版本 : 20xx 年 4 月 10 日 第 5 页 共 8 页 基于指定项目的特性,对构架系统程序单元大小( S/M/C)的估计进行修正。 取得全部的项目程序单元 /模块。 对于软件程序单元的划分是基于对项目程序单元复杂程度的定义 . 该定义通常和采用的语言 , 开发环境 , 和开发人员的经验相关 . 各项目所采用标准应归纳总结于相应表格 , 如下所示 : 复杂度 单元复杂度标准 估计的工作量 (PersonDays) 简单( SIMPLE) Program with minimum business logic, no more than 23 table access, and very little data display 4 中等( MEDIUM) Programs with moderate business logic, 24 table access, and m。阅读剩余 0%
本站所有文章资讯、展示的图片素材等内容均为注册用户上传(部分报媒/平媒内容转载自网络合作媒体),仅供学习参考。
用户通过本站上传、发布的任何内容的知识产权归属用户或原始著作权人所有。如有侵犯您的版权,请联系我们反馈本站将在三个工作日内改正。